Two Sedan volunteer firefighters are getting attention this week as a video shows a pair fighting a vehicle fire at the Padua St. Patrick’s Day Parade.

Their efforts are to be expected as volunteer firefighters, but the fact that Ted Aubart and Ben Terhaar were there well-dressed – in full length designer dresses – is what is gaining the viewer interest….

Aubart and Terhaar wear the dresses on occasion as part of a fund-raising effort for the Sedan Volunteer Fire Department. The group was waiting in line in preparation for Padua’s St. Patrick’s Day Parade Saturday when a fire erupted on a truck and the firefighters went to work.

Students Evacuated After School Bathroom Fire in Savage

Firefighters in Savage are on the scene of a small bathroom fire at an elementary school.

Firefighters remain on scene at Harriet Bishop Elementary School on the 14,000 block of O’connell Road.

Ruth Dunn of the Burnsville-Eagan-Savage School District tells KSTP.com the fire started in one of the bathrooms of the school.

Dunn says the district had school busses take students and staff to a nearby fire station.
